'Diamond Head' Elephant Ear (Colocasia esculenta 'Diamond Head') is a striking tropical plant featuring large, glossy, deep purple to black leaves with a ruffled texture. Ideal for adding dramatic contrast to gardens and containers, this variety thrives in full sun to partial shade and well-drained soil.
Planting Information:
Soil Requirements: Well-drained soil
Hardiness Zones: 8 to 11
Light Requirements: Full sun to partial shade
Plant Spacing: 24-36 inches
Planting Depth: 3-4 inches
Mature Height: 36 to 48 inches
Bloom Time: Foliage plant; primarily grown for its leaves
Suitable Zones: 3 to 11 (as an annual or overwintered indoors in cooler zones)
Planting Time: Spring planting
Note: 'Diamond Head' Elephant Ear is deer resistant and grows well in containers. In zones 4-7, plant in a container and bring indoors during winter months to enjoy year after year.
Caution: All parts of the plant are toxic if ingested and may cause skin irritation; handle with care.
